Outside of the parks, try
Napa Rose in Disney's Grand Californian Hotel & Spa. The food is divine and it's a very elevated setting with impeccable service. At Disney California Adventure Park,
Carthay Circle Restaurant on Buena Vista Street is also a very special dining experience with a classic Hollywood-style setting. For an iconic, immersive dining location, go with
Blue Bayou Restaurant in New Orleans Square in Disneyland Park where you'll dine in perpetual twilight in the bayou as boats float by. The cuisine is Cajun and Creole-inspired, and while the menu frequently changes, you'll currently find the popular Monte Cristo on the lunch menu. We've enjoyed our meals at all of these Table Service dining locations and highly recommend them.
Alternately, you could go with a
Character Dining meal, so your friend can meet her favorite Characters, while you dine. There are several different options both inside and outside the park, and different locations feature different Characters. If you happen to know her favorites, it can guide your choice. Or take a peek at the menus if you want to be guided by your appetite!
Goofy's Kitchen in Disneyland Hotel is a really classic choice.
Another idea is to pair your meal with a great view of the fireworks in Disneyland Park.
Tomorrowland Skyline Terrace dining package available in Tomorrowland offers bird's eye views of the nighttime entertainment and the twinkling skyline of the park. When selecting your night, be sure to check the
Entertainment Schedule! Nighttime entertainment varies and is subject to cancelation.
Dining reservations typically open 60 days in advance early in the morning. All of these suggestions are subject to availability and can be hard spots to grab if you're not ready to make your reservation when they open up. Make a reminder on your mobile device for that 60-day mark for each day of your visit!

And don't forget her complimentary
Celebration Button, which you can pick up at Guest Services in Disney California Adventure Park or City Hall on Main Street, U.S.A. in Disneyland Park. This complimentary button will let everyone know she's celebrating her first visit, and you never know what magic will happen!
